Xbox Live House Party prices and dates

Posted by

We already know the lineup for the third Xbox Live House Party and know we also know how much and when each of the four titles will be available. The promotion will kick off on the fifteenth with Warp for 800 points. The game casts you as a cute alien attempting to teleport it’s way out of a research facility. A week later on the twenty-second the real heavy hitter of the promotion comes in the form of Alan Wake’s American Nightmare which naturally costs 1,200 points. This downloadable follow-up to last year’s full game seems to be more focussed on the action but there will be at least some forward progression to the plot.

Nexuiz is coming on the twenty-ninth and that game has a bizarre lineage. It was once an open-source arena shooter running on the Quake engine that was built and maintained by it’s fans. It is now an arena based shooter running on the Crysis 2 engine and being put out by Illfonic who are owned by the singer Rafeal Sadiiq. It will costs you 8oo points. Last up and it’s often delayed suvival-sim I Am Alive. It’ll cost 1,200 points and rounds out the promotion. You will get 800 points if you buy all four games during the promotion.
